Investment portfolio

  • FluidAI Medical

    Participated · Series A · Oct 2023

    FluidAI Medical (formerly NERv Technology Inc.) develops the Stream™ Platform, which combines advanced sensors and an AI-driven algorithm to help surgeons detect postoperative leaks earlier and improve clinical outcomes. Led by CEO Youssef Helwa and based in Kitchener, Canada, the company is focused on postoperative patient monitoring and plans to broaden its clinical indications. FluidAI intends to use its recent financing to expand into existing and new global markets, grow its team, and amplify R&D efforts. The company aims to introduce novel AI-driven solutions addressing a wider range of postoperative complications. Its current financial position was bolstered by a $15M Series A announced in October 2023. No operating metrics were disclosed in the article. NERv Technology has developed an all-in-one sensory platform (hardware and software) designed to help doctors monitor postoperative patients remotely by detecting leakages from catheters and wound drains that can lead to critical complications. The device attaches to catheters and wound drains and moved the company from prototype to a product-launch phase over the past year. NERv commenced clinical studies, including a multi-site feasibility study led by researchers from St. Michael’s Hospital and Hamilton Health Sciences, and has grown its team from about 16 to 24 employees. The startup manufactures devices locally in Waterloo and recently relocated operations to the Medical Innovation Xchange (MIX) to access lab space and commercialization expertise. NERv plans to use new funding to secure regulatory approval, complete clinical studies, and scale manufacturing and assembly locally, with expectations to seek Health Canada approval first and later pursue approval in the United States and Middle East. NERv Technology has built a sensory platform designed to detect anastomotic leakage—a postoperative leak of gastrointestinal contents into the abdominal cavity—capable of identifying leaks in a matter of minutes. The startup says its solution targets a major clinical problem: about 1.7 million high‑risk abdominal surgeries occur annually in the US, with complications arising in roughly 8% of patients and contributing to at least 13,000 deaths per year. NERv was co‑founded in 2014 by CEO Youssef Helwa and COO/co‑founder Amr Abdelgawad, both University of Waterloo engineering graduates; the executive team also includes CTO Abdallah El‑Falou and lead scientist Mohamed Okasha. The company has completed the first phase of preclinical studies and plans to begin regulatory submissions, clinical studies, and pilot programs as it approaches commercialization. Financially, prior to this round NERv had raised under $1M CAD from non‑dilutive sources and government grants. The new funding is intended to support further preclinical research and development of a flagship post‑operative surgery platform.

  • Spintly

    Participated · Series A · Nov 2022

    Spintly develops a hardware-enabled, software-controlled access management platform that eliminates the need for traditional wiring by using its proprietary Bluetooth Low Energy (BLE) mesh networking technology. The system lets enterprises quickly retrofit or install door controllers, badges, and readers while maintaining secure local log storage during power outages. Spintly is layering AI-driven analytics onto existing camera infrastructure to enhance security insights for its customers. The company targets enterprise clients that operate large commercial buildings and multi-site facilities across India, the Middle East & Africa, and the United States. Founded by Rohin Parkar, Spintly combines wireless hardware devices with cloud software for centralized management. Financially, the company has secured an $8 million Series A round and previously closed a ₹3.5 crore extended seed round in January last year along with an earlier $5.36 million seed raise. The fresh capital will be used for product development, global expansion, and strengthening its AI capabilities.

  • Rhaeos

    Participated · Seed · Jan 2022

    Rhaeos is a clinical-stage medical device company focused on addressing unmet needs in the care of people with hydrocephalus and developing wearable sensors for chronic conditions. Its core product, the FlowSense shunt monitor, is a wireless, non-invasive thermal sensor delivered as a small, bandage-sized patch that adheres above implanted shunt tubing. FlowSense rapidly monitors shunt function and wirelessly transmits critical data to a mobile app in minutes to support clinical decision making. Rhaeos received FDA Breakthrough Device Designation for FlowSense in 2020 and is currently evaluating the device in a multi-center FDA pivotal study in the US. The company intends to use the Series A proceeds to support an in-hospital launch of FlowSense and anticipates making the monitor commercially available to physicians and patients in 2023. The company is led by CEO Anna Lisa Somera. Rhaeos is a private, clinical-stage medical device company based in Evanston, Ill., formed out of the John A. Rogers Research Group at Northwestern University. The company is developing FlowSense™, a noninvasive wireless wearable sensor that addresses a clinical unmet need for patients with hydrocephalus and is initially targeted at the neurosurgical suite. Rhaeos has received support from federal and nonprofit sources, including the National Institutes of Health and the National Science Foundation, as well as foundations and pediatric device consortia. The company closed a $2.2M seed financing and has secured more than $8M in total dilutive and non-dilutive financing to date. Proceeds from the seed round will be used to prepare for the 2022 commercial launch of FlowSense. Additional institutional and accelerator supporters include MedTech Innovator and several pediatric device accelerators and consortiums.

  • AOA

    Participated · Seed · Jun 2021

    AOA Dx is a NYC-based company developing a detection test for ovarian cancer using its GlycoLocate™ platform. The platform focuses on glycolipids and tumor marker gangliosides and harnesses novel biomarkers through data science to improve early detection. Led by CEO and co‑founder Oriana Papin‑Zoghbi, the company’s initial focus is ovarian cancer. AOA Dx plans to use the new capital to open new lab facilities, expand its prospective ovarian cancer clinical trial (OVERT), and develop GlycoLocate into additional cancer areas. The company raised $17M in the latest round led by Good Growth Capital and has now raised $24M in total. Investors in the round include RH Capital, Y Combinator, Astia Fund, Adaptive Capital Partners, Gore Range Capital, LongeVC, The Helm, VU Venture Partners, FemHealth Ventures and diagnostic investors such as Labcorp Venture Fund. AOA Dx is developing AKRIVIS GD, a liquid‑biopsy assay intended to enable accurate early detection of ovarian cancer. In a landmark peer‑reviewed study in the Journal of Precision Medicine, the technology showed over 90% accuracy for detecting ovarian cancer, including early‑stage disease. The company says AKRIVIS GD has high sensitivity and specificity and would be the first available tool to enable early detection of ovarian cancer. AOA plans to use new funding to further develop the next generation of AKRIVIS GD and to expand its team. Teams are based in Boston, New York, and London, and the company participated in Y Combinator’s program in 2021. The work responds to a large unmet need: roughly 225,000 women are diagnosed annually and late detection drives high mortality, while early detection can dramatically improve five‑year survival rates. AOA is developing AKRIVIS GD, a blood-based liquid biopsy intended to detect ovarian cancer at earlier stages. The company reports that its proof-of-concept demonstrates high accuracy across all cancer stages and epithelial ovarian cancer subtypes. AOA says its technology detects 53% more patients with early-stage disease compared with the current standard, CA 125. The team partnered with Professor H. Uri Saragovi of the Lady Davis Institute/McGill University to develop the test. AOA is part of Y Combinator’s summer 2021 batch and raised seed funding to advance development. The company plans further prospective patient clinical trials and to pursue FDA regulatory processes to bring the test to market.

  • Astrocyte Pharmaceuticals

    Participated · Series A · May 2021

    Astrocyte Pharmaceuticals is a privately held, clinical-stage biopharmaceutical company based in Groton, Conn., focused on developing novel cerebroprotective therapeutics. Its lead candidate, AST-004, has shown efficacy across diverse small and large animal brain injury models and is being evaluated for a broad array of acute brain injuries including stroke and traumatic brain injury. Astrocyte is currently conducting Phase 1B clinical safety studies of AST-004 and is preparing for Phase 2 efficacy studies in 2024. The company is also assessing AST-004 in preclinical models of Alzheimer's disease to explore potential benefits in chronic neurodegenerative conditions. The announced financing will be used to accelerate clinical development of AST-004 and further preclinical assessment in Alzheimer's disease. Astrocyte positions its approach as a potential way to reduce astrocyte-induced excess inflammation and provide neuroprotection in combination and precision medicine strategies. Astrocyte Pharmaceuticals is advancing novel neuroprotective therapeutics intended to reduce brain injury from stroke, traumatic brain injury, concussion and other neurodegenerative conditions. Its lead therapeutic is based on technology licensed from the University of Texas Health Science Center at San Antonio. The company completed a Series A financing that raised $6 million. Proceeds from the round will be used to advance the lead program into Phase 1 human trials. Astrocyte describes itself as focused on addressing an unmet need for drugs that limit neurodegenerative brain injury. No operating metrics were disclosed in the article. Astrocyte Pharmaceuticals is a privately held drug development company focused on small‑molecule neuroprotective therapeutics for stroke, traumatic brain injury/concussion, and neurodegenerative disorders. The company is committed to proving the neuroprotective benefits of enhancing astrocyte function and advancing related therapeutic agents. Its lead program is AST‑004, which the company and investors cite as having promising preclinical efficacy and a novel mechanism of action. Astrocyte completed a Pre‑A financing that raised over $2.3M to support its development plans. The company intends to use proceeds to advance its first program into clinical studies. The press release also notes research support from the National Institute of Neurological Disorders and Stroke (NIH) and the Department of Defense under specific award numbers.
